What are the licensing requirements for daycare providers in Olar, South Carolina, and how can I verify a facility is properly licensed?

In Olar, as in all of South Carolina, childcare facilities must be licensed by the South Carolina Department of Social Services (SCDSS). This includes family childcare homes (caring for 6-12 children) and group childcare centers. Licensing ensures providers meet minimum standards for health, safety, staff-to-child ratios, background checks, and training. To verify a facility's license status, you can use the SCDSS Child Care Search tool online or contact the SCDSS Child Care Licensing office directly. Given Olar's smaller, rural setting, many options may be registered family homes, so it's crucial to confirm their current license is in good standing before enrolling your child.

Are there any state-funded or subsidized childcare programs available to families in Olar?

Yes, eligible families in Olar can apply for the South Carolina Child Care Voucher Program, administered by the SC Department of Social Services. This subsidy helps low-income working families, those in job training, or parents attending school afford licensed childcare. Eligibility is based on income, family size, and need. Due to Olar's rural location, it's important to apply early, as funding can be limited and waitlists may exist. You can apply through the Bamberg County DSS office. Additionally, some local providers may offer sliding scale fees, so it's always worth asking about financial flexibility.

What are some local resources or people I can contact to help find and evaluate childcare options in Olar?

A valuable local resource is the Bamberg County First Steps office. As part of the SC First Steps statewide initiative, they work to improve early childhood education and can provide referrals to licensed providers in Olar and the county. You can also connect with other parents through community hubs like the Olar Town Hall, local churches, or Facebook community groups for firsthand recommendations. For evaluating quality, look beyond basic licensing; ask providers about their curriculum, daily routines, and if they participate in the ABC Quality program, South Carolina's voluntary quality rating and improvement system for childcare.
